What is disempowerment in aged care?

Disempowerment in aged care refers to the loss of control, independence, and decision-making ability experienced by older adults receiving care. This can happen when their preferences and choices are not respected, when they are not included in decision-making processes, or when their autonomy is undermined by others. Disempowerment can have negative impacts on the well-being and quality of life of older adults in aged care settings.

Why aged care clients may feel Disempowerment?

Aged care clients may feel disempowered due to a lack of autonomy and control over their own lives, feeling that decisions are being made for them rather than with them. This can lead to feelings of helplessness, frustration, and diminished self-worth. Factors like limited choices, lack of communication, and a loss of independence can all contribute to feelings of disempowerment in aged care clients.


What is the opposite of empowerment?

The opposite of empowerment is disempowerment, which refers to the deprivation of power, authority, or control over one's own life or circumstances. It can result in feelings of helplessness, inadequacy, and dependency.
